Expert Tips
You can also make this on the stovetop. Add all the ingredients except the cheese to a large saucepan.
Simmer for 10-15 minutes until the tortellini is tender. Sprinkle the cheese on top and allow to melt. Serve and enjoy.

Crockpot Tortellini Recipe
Equipment
Ingredients
- 9 ounces tortellini (or ravioli)
- 5 ounces fresh baby spinach
- 14 ounces pasta sauce
- ½ cup heavy cream
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
Instructions
- Pour about half of the pasta sauce into the bottom of the slow cooker.
- Add the tortellini or ravioli.
- Mix the remaining pasta sauce and heavy cream. Pour over the ravioli.
- Sprinkle the Italian seasoning over sauce.
- Add the spinach and toss to coat.
- Layer the mozzarella cheese on top.
- Turn the crockpot on low, cover and cook for 4 hours or until the pasta is tender.
